Plant Doctor & Care for Japanese Spurge – Iowa Guide: Step-by-Step & Yield Tips

In the heart of the Midwest, where the soil is rich and the seasons ever-changing, the Japanese Spurge (Pachysandra terminalis) has found a thriving home in Iowa’s gardens and landscapes. This evergreen groundcover, with its glossy, dark-green leaves and delicate white flowers, has become a staple in many Iowan homeowners’ repertoire. However, as with any plant, proper care and maintenance are essential to ensure its continued health and vibrant growth.

In this comprehensive guide, we’ll delve into the world of Japanese Spurge, exploring its unique characteristics, optimal growing conditions, and step-by-step care instructions tailored specifically for the Iowa region. Whether you’re a seasoned green thumb or a novice gardener, this guide will equip you with the knowledge and tools necessary to become a Japanese Spurge plant doctor, ensuring your garden’s flourishing success.

Understanding the Japanese Spurge

The Japanese Spurge, also known as the Pachysandra, is a perennial evergreen groundcover native to Japan, China, and parts of the eastern United States. In Iowa, it has found a welcoming home, thriving in the region’s moderate climate and well-drained soils.

One of the key features that make the Japanese Spurge a popular choice for Iowan gardeners is its ability to adapt to a wide range of soil types and light conditions. From partially shaded areas to sun-drenched spots, this versatile plant can hold its own, making it an excellent choice for both residential and commercial landscaping projects.

In addition to its adaptability, the Japanese Spurge is prized for its evergreen foliage, which provides year-round visual interest and ground cover. Its glossy, dark-green leaves and delicate white flowers, which bloom in the spring, add a touch of natural elegance to any garden or landscape.

Optimal Growing Conditions for Japanese Spurge in Iowa

To ensure the optimal growth and health of your Japanese Spurge in Iowa, it’s essential to understand the plant’s specific environmental requirements. By creating the ideal growing conditions, you can help your Pachysandra thrive and reach its full potential.

Soil Preferences

  • Well-drained, loamy soil with a slightly acidic pH (between 5.5 and 6.5)
  • Avoid heavy, clay-based soils as they can lead to root rot and other issues
  • Incorporate organic matter, such as compost or peat moss, to improve soil structure and nutrient content

Sunlight Needs

  • Partial shade to full shade is ideal for Japanese Spurge in Iowa
  • The plant can tolerate some morning sun, but extended exposure to direct sunlight may cause leaf scorch and stress
  • Ensure the planting site receives at least 4-6 hours of dappled or filtered sunlight per day

Watering Requirements

  • Keep the soil consistently moist, but not waterlogged
  • Water the plant regularly, especially during periods of drought or hot, dry weather
  • Avoid letting the soil completely dry out, as this can lead to wilting and potentially damage the plant

Step-by-Step Care Guide for Japanese Spurge in Iowa

Now that you understand the optimal growing conditions for Japanese Spurge in Iowa, let’s dive into the step-by-step care instructions to ensure your plant’s long-term health and vigor.

Planting and Establishment

  • Choose a suitable planting site that meets the soil and light requirements outlined earlier
  • Prepare the planting area by loosening the soil and incorporating organic matter, such as compost or well-rotted manure
  • Plant the Japanese Spurge at the same depth it was growing in the container, spacing the plants 12-18 inches apart
  • Water the plants thoroughly after planting to help establish the root system
  • Mulch the area around the plants with 2-3 inches of organic mulch, such as wood chips or shredded bark, to help retain moisture and suppress weeds

Ongoing Maintenance

  • Water the plants regularly, ensuring the soil remains consistently moist but not waterlogged
  • Apply a balanced, slow-release fertilizer in early spring to provide essential nutrients for healthy growth
  • Prune or trim the plants as needed to maintain their shape and prevent overcrowding
  • Remove any dead or damaged leaves or flowers to keep the plant looking its best
  • Monitor for pests or diseases and address any issues promptly to prevent further damage

Overwintering and Cold Protection

  • In the fall, apply a layer of organic mulch around the base of the plants to protect the roots from frost heave
  • If your region experiences harsh winters, consider covering the plants with a layer of burlap or other lightweight fabric to provide additional insulation
  • Avoid excessive foot traffic or compaction of the soil around the plants during the winter months

Troubleshooting Common Issues with Japanese Spurge in Iowa

Even with the best care and attention, your Japanese Spurge may encounter occasional challenges. Here are some common issues and how to address them:

Leaf Scorch or Discoloration

  • Caused by excessive sun exposure or drought stress
  • Remedy: Provide more shade or increase watering frequency

Fungal Diseases

  • Common issues include powdery mildew, root rot, and leaf spot
  • Remedy: Improve air circulation, reduce moisture, and use fungicides as a last resort

Pest Infestations

  • Watch out for pests like aphids, mealybugs, and spider mites
  • Remedy: Apply organic insecticidal soap or neem oil to affected areas

Slow or Stunted Growth

  • Caused by poor soil conditions, insufficient nutrients, or competition from weeds
  • Remedy: Amend the soil, apply a balanced fertilizer, and remove any nearby weeds

Maximizing Yields and Expanding Your Japanese Spurge Patch

With the proper care and attention, your Japanese Spurge can thrive in Iowa, providing a lush, evergreen groundcover that will enhance your garden’s beauty year-round. To maximize your yields and expand your Japanese Spurge patch, consider the following tips:

Propagation and Division

  • Japanese Spurge can be easily propagated through division, allowing you to create new plants from the existing ones
  • In the early spring or late fall, carefully dig up the plant and divide the root system into smaller sections, ensuring each section has at least one healthy crown
  • Replant the divided sections in prepared soil and water thoroughly to encourage new growth

Companion Planting

  • Consider pairing your Japanese Spurge with other shade-loving plants, such as ferns, hostas, or shade-tolerant annuals
  • This can create a visually appealing and synergistic planting scheme, while also helping to suppress weeds and retain moisture

Expanding the Patch

  • Japanese Spurge spreads gradually through underground rhizomes, allowing you to expand your existing patch over time
  • Carefully monitor the plant’s growth and transplant or divide sections as needed to create a lush, continuous groundcover
  • Be mindful of the plant’s spread, as it can become invasive if left unchecked in certain environments
